On Composition: Negative Space

Jun 25, 2026 ·3 views

Photographers often overcrowd their frames. Negative space - the deliberate emptiness around a subject - draws the viewer's eye exactly where you want it.

In bridal photography especially, leaving room around the subject can communicate solitude, anticipation, or quiet joy. Try it on your next session: include 30-40% empty frame and see how the story changes.
